Same here. I always work in 'Page View'. My largest table right now is
apprx. 130 pages - set up in A4 - not US Letter... No problems with page
breaks. My tables consists of 2 or 3 columns.
But I have noticed one big thing working with such large tables. NWP
gets extremely slow when exceeding 100 pages with text only tables.
A work-around for this is to make such large tables into 'chapters' so
each table will be smaller, and the final document then contains more
tables - here for example 30 tables consisting of 2 or 3 columns - i.e.
1 table for 1 chapter.
...And NWP will definitely be as fast as if it only contained 10-20
pages of pure text.:-)
